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-5 ACMG points: 1P and 6B. PP2BP4_ModerateBS2
The NM_001042603.3(KDM5A):āc.5020T>Gā(p.Ser1674Ala)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000013 in 1,613,892 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Ambry Genetics | Sep 04, 2024 | The c.5020T>G (p.S1674A) alteration is located in exon 28 (coding exon 28) of the KDM5A gene. This alteration results from a T to G substitution at nucleotide position 5020, causing the serine (S) at amino acid position 1674 to be replaced by an alanine (A).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. - |
